The growth hormone releasing peptide, in plain words

This therapy involves a specialized compounded prescription. It is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. This GHRH analog works by stimulating your own pituitary gland. Your pituitary gland then releases its stored grow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ile manner. This differs significantly from introducing exogenous growth hormone directly.

This natural stimulation supports your body’s intrinsic systems. It aims to restore more youthful levels of your own growth hormone. Higher natural growth hormone levels may support better sleep, improved body composition, and enhanced recovery. Many patients report feeling more energetic and experiencing deeper, more restorative sleep patterns.

What patients typically report

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.

Adult relaxing at home checking telehealth treatment progress on a smartphone
  1. Weeks 1 to 4

    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.

  2. Weeks 5 to 8

    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.

  3. Weeks 9 to 12

    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.

  4. Month 4 and beyond

    A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.

What about side effects?

Reported side effects are generally mild and include injection site redness, transient flushing and occasional headache. Sermorelin uses your own pituitary gland, which tends to be safer than synthetic HGH because the body retains its natural feedback loop.
